EXTRAORDINARY WORLD WITH JEFF CORWIN
“Plastic, Pollution and Pelicans” – Jeff Corwin visits a critical habitat in southern Florida littered with plastic trash. He’s joined by the volunteers of Clean This Beach Up and the team to demonstrate the power of how individual action leads to larger impact. Then, Jeff partners with the Pelican Harbor Seabird Station where a variety of birds are being treated from injury. Jeff helps the staff prep one lucky osprey, injured by a hurricane, to return back into the wild and regain its vital role in the ecosystem. (OAD 1/11/25)

The CBS WKND block is FCC educational/informational compliant, targeted to 13- to 16-year-olds and appealing to all viewers. All the programs are specifically designed to further the educational and informational needs of children, have educating and informing children as a significant purpose and otherwise meet the definition of Core Programming as specified in the Commission’s rules.
